GNU/Linux >> Znalost Linux >  >> Linux

Jak trvale nastavit název hostitele v ubuntu bez restartu

Název hostitele je název počítače, který se používá k identifikaci konkrétního hostitele v počítačové síti. Může to být libovolná hloubka. Mohlo by to být tak jednoduché jako john nebo komplexní jako jan.example.com . Pokud není název hostitele nastaven správně, programy, jako jsou poštovní servery a další počítače v síti, vydají varování nebo zcela selžou.

Ve výchozím nastavení je název hostitele nastaven systémem automaticky, ale v některých případech chceme tento název pro pohodlí změnit a můžeme to snadno provést pomocí následujících kroků:

1. Nejprve změňte aktuální název hostitele

$ hostname MY_NEW_NAME

Tato změna je dočasná, dokud se systém nerestartuje. Ale je to dobré, protože nemáte žádné prostoje.

2. Aktualizujte soubor názvu hostitele /etc/hostname

Můžeme to udělat jedním z následujících způsobů:

# For newer distribution, that use `SystemD` init
$ sudo hostnamectl set-hostname MY_NEW_HOSTNAME
# For older distribution, `SysV` init 
$ sudo echo "my-new-hostname" > /etc/hostname

3. Přidejte nový záznam do /etc/hosts soubor

$ sudo echo "127.0.0.1 my-new-hostname" > /etc/hosts
# or directly open `/etc/hosts` file 
$ sudo nano /etc/hosts

Po provedených změnách váš nový /etc/hosts soubor vypadá takto:

127.0.0.1       localhost
127.0.0.1       guest
127.0.1.1       my-new-hostname
# other entries below
## ..
## ..

Linux
  1. Jak nastavit nebo změnit název hostitele systému v systému Linux

  2. Ubuntu – Jak nastavit statickou IP v Ubuntu?

  3. Jak restartuji bluetooth v Ubuntu?

  1. Jak nastavit klíče SSH na Ubuntu 18.04

  2. Jak nastavit Unbound DNS Resolver na Ubuntu 20.04

  3. Jak změnit název hostitele na Ubuntu

  1. Jak změnit název hostitele na Ubuntu 18.04

  2. 2 způsoby, jak trvale nastavit proměnnou $PATH v ubuntu

  3. Jak nastavit $LD_LIBRARY_PATH v Ubuntu?